Bitwise AND and Set Flags (Immediate)

ANDS <Wd>, <Wn>, #<imm>

Bitwise AND immediate, updates flags.

Pseudocode Operation

result ← Wn AND imm
Wd ← result
N ← result[31]
Z ← (result == 0)
C ← 0
V ← 0

Example

ANDS w0, w1, #16

Reference

Instruction Forms

Encoding Instruction ISA Bit pattern
0x72000000 ANDS <Wd>, <Wn>, #<imm> A64 0 | 11 | 100100 | 0 | immr | imms | Rn | Rd
0xF2000000 ANDS <Xd>, <Xn>, #<imm> A64 1 | 11 | 100100 | N | immr | imms | Rn | Rd
0x6A000000 ANDS <Wd>, <Wn>, <Wm>{, <shift> #<amount>} A64 0 | 11 | 01010 | shift | 0 | Rm | imm6 | Rn | Rd
0xEA000000 ANDS <Xd>, <Xn>, <Xm>{, <shift> #<amount>} A64 1 | 11 | 01010 | shift | 0 | Rm | imm6 | Rn | Rd
0x25404000 ANDS <Pd>.B, <Pg>/Z, <Pn>.B, <Pm>.B A64 00100101 | 0 | 1 | 00 | Pm | 01 | Pg | 0 | Pn | 0 | Pd

Description

Bitwise AND (immediate), setting flags, performs a bitwise AND of a register value and an immediate value, and writes the result to the destination register. It updates the condition flags based on the result.

Operation

bits(datasize) result;
bits(datasize) operand1 = X[n, datasize];

result = operand1 AND imm;
PSTATE.<N,Z,C,V> = result<datasize-1>:IsZeroBit(result):'00';

X[d, datasize] = result;
